What Are Dental Bonding and Contouring?

Dental bonding involves applying a tooth-colored composite resin to correct imperfections like chips and discoloration. The resin is carefully shaped to match your tooth’s natural form and then hardened using a special curing light. This minimally invasive procedure typically requires no anesthesia.

Tooth contouring—also known as dental reshaping—involves removing small amounts of enamel to smooth edges, shorten teeth, and fix minor flaws. This treatment is ideal for patients with slight deformities or surface imperfections.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. How long do the results last?
With proper care, dental bonding can last 3 to 10 years. Tooth contouring results are permanent, as enamel does not regenerate. To prolong results, maintain good oral hygiene and avoid habits like nail-biting or chewing hard objects.

2. Are there any risks or side effects?
Both procedures are considered safe. Bonding materials may stain over time, especially with frequent consumption of coffee, tea, or red wine. Since contouring removes enamel permanently, it’s essential to confirm that the procedure suits your dental needs.

3. Will my insurance cover these procedures?
Most dental insurance plans do not cover bonding and contouring, as they are considered cosmetic. However, partial coverage for bonding may be available if it addresses a functional issue, such as repairing a tooth that affects your bite.

4. What steps should I follow to maintain my teeth post-treatment?
Brush and floss regularly to keep your teeth clean. Avoid biting into hard objects and stay away from stain-causing foods and beverages for at least 48 hours post-treatment. Regular dental checkups will help monitor the condition of your treated teeth.
